Blueberries with peaches are a favorite combination for me. So it was easy enough to use that as the basis for my blueberry recipe.
And since I do a lot of summer grilling, it made good sense to grill up some peaches then mix them with blueberries in a side salad. A little mild onion, a few toasted nuts and some goat cheese round it out with a blueberry vinaigrette.
You can use the goat cheese crumbles that come in a tub if you like to keep things easy.
Blueberry vinegar I make myself and you can use my recipe if you don’t have one. Or some stores will sell the vinegar. Another option is to just use wine vinegar.
But if you are making your own plan on doing that a few weeks in advance. It keeps a long time in a cool dry dark place so one batch will have you covered most of the summer.
The microgreens can be bought in many places now. I prefer the rocket sprouts (arugula) but you can use others or radish sprouts or alfalfa sprouts.
My dressing isn’t sugared so if you like it sweet, whisk a small amount of sugar in the vinegar to your taste. I find the fruit sweetens it perfectly for me.

Grilled Peach and Blueberry Salad
Equipment
- 1 outdoor grill
Ingredients
- 1 ripe peach
- 3 cups red leaf lettuce chopped
- 3/4 cup fresh blueberries
- 1/4 cup toasted sliced almonds
- 1 slice red onion separated into rings
- 1/4 cup soft goat cheese crumbles chevre
- 2 tablespoons microgreens or alfalfa sprouts
- 2 tablespoons blueberry vinegar or white wine vinegar
- 2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
- 1/8 teaspoon salt
- 1/8 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Preheat grill.
- Slice around the midsection of a ripe peach, then twist gently to separate halves.
- Pry out the pit. No need to remove skin.
- Cut into slices and lightly drizzle with oil.
- Spray grill grate with nonstick spray and place on hot grill.
- Allow slices to char on each side and remove. Do not overcook.
- Assemble all ingredients among two salad plates and serve.
